What's The Definition Of Ombudswoman?

ombudswoman
countable noun: The ombudswoman is an independent official who has been appointed to investigate complaints that people make against the government or public organizations.

ombudswoman in American English
noun: a woman employed to investigate complaints against government or institutional officials, employers, etc
